ATTACK helicopters, parachutists and military bands will take over Colchester’s Abbey Field.

The Colchester Garrison Show returns on Saturday, July 4, with the Parachute Regiment’s Red Devils making an entrance from the skies. It is the second time the show has been staged, the last time being in 2013.

This year’s event will support Colchester Nepalese Society’s fundraising for victims of the Nepal earthquakes with bucket collections being held. The event itself will be free. Col Gary Wilkinson, commander of Colchester Garrison, said: “The Nepalese community is a significant part of the local population, both military and civilian, and it is important we all support their efforts to rebuild their home country. The showwill also be a chance to see 16 Air Assault Brigade in action.” Alongside the show, runners will take part in the Paras’ 10, a ten-mile run which sees people carrying a 35lb rucksack and wearing boots.

Active Essex will host a schools’ and families’ athletics competition.
